Ticket: Staging env misconfigured for Siftgate bloom filter

The bloom layer in front of the Pellet KV store is rejecting all lookups in staging because the env file was copied from the dev template without credentials. False-positive tuning values are fine; only the auth line is missing. To unblock the weekly demo, the Pellet admission secret must be set on the following line.

env line for yaguf-fajop: LEDGER_TOKEN13=fb08984397349

Handover note — Crumbwheel order cutoffs.

Welcome aboard. The bakery cutoff rule in Crumbwheel closes same-day orders at 14:00 local to each storefront, not UTC — this has bitten us twice. Holiday overrides live in the calendar service and take precedence silently, so always check there first when a cutoff looks wrong. To unlock the calendar service's admin console after a restart, enter the recovery passphrase below.

vault phrase of bagap-bahaf = silion-pelox-sorox-casdor-quenwyn-fraax-eliox-praael-kelion-quenvan-kasox-rusael-norius-belvan

Release checklist: verify mobile deep-link routing in the Larkspur app before Thursday's cutover. Confirm that promo links open the correct in-app screen on both platforms, and that malformed paths fall back to the home view rather than crashing. QA signed off on staging. The verified build token is below.

build token for kagaf-hahof: htk14_9d3d4d26d7d8de

## Account Recovery — Trailnote Offline Mode

When a surveyor's Trailnote app has been offline for 30+ days, their local credentials expire and sync refuses to resume. Don't make them wipe the device — all their unsynced field data lives there! Instead, open the support console, pick "Offline Reinstate," and enter their handle. The console will ask for the support team's shared recovery passphrase before issuing a reinstatement token. Use the one below.

unlock words, bagaf-fajeg: zorael-kelax-fraath-quenix-eliok-sileth-aldmir-wenir-druiel